This was one of my concerns too, the plates could just end up hanging on the wall in the garage.
When the car was coming over on the boat, I brought V28 DAN as know I couldn't make the car newer so went a year older to be sure it could be assigned to the car.
I'm buying the new plate though Regtransfers.co.uk they done some checks, the DVLA have it on record it's a 2000 model(which is correct) however it's going to come down to a month. It's going to be tight. They think it can be assigned, but if it can't then I don't have to complete the purchase.

Renewed a couple of pipes.
Pipe between to valve cover and throttle body was a little short, well tight.
1000088017.jpg


New braided 10mm pipe added with jubilee clips.
1000088022.jpg


Also the steam vent pipe that comes from the top of the block to the radiator wasn't nice. So renewed that too. Old thick pipe was very squidgy.
1000088016.jpg


Also has a barbed adapter from 10mm to 8mm inside. Where before it was a dodgy bit of metal pipe that wasn't gripping at all.
1000088024.jpg
 
Used some Gunk engine cleaner. Its stpray on stuff, leave it for a few mins then jetwash off.

Main reason for that is new bits look nice, but some parts are not so nice, wanted to start with clean metalwork. I aim to paint this black with POR15 before Brands Hatch Speedfest in 1 weeks time.
